Understanding Your Sleep Cycle: Tips for Better Sleep

Sleep is an essential component of our overall health and well-being. During sleep, our body repairs and rejuvenates itself, and our brain processes and consolidates memories. However, many people struggle to get the quality and quantity of sleep they need. One factor that can impact the quality of your sleep is your sleep cycle.

What is a sleep cycle?

A sleep cycle is a series of stages that your body goes through during sleep. There are two main types of sleep: rapid eye movement (REM) sleep and non-rapid eye movement (NREM) sleep. NREM sleep is further divided into three stages: N1, N2, and N3. Each stage of the sleep cycle has unique characteristics and serves a specific purpose.

Stage 1 (N1): This is the transition stage between wakefulness and sleep. Your body is starting to relax, and your brain waves slow down.

Stage 2 (N2): This is the stage of light sleep. Your heart rate and breathing rate slow down, and your body temperature drops.

Stage 3 (N3): This is the stage of deep sleep. Your brain waves slow down even further, and your body is completely relaxed. This is when your body repairs and regenerates tissues, strengthening your immune system.

REM sleep: This is the stage of dreaming sleep. Your eyes move rapidly back and forth, and your brain activity is similar to when you are awake. This is when your brain processes and consolidates memories.

How long is a sleep cycle?

A sleep cycle typically lasts between 90 and 120 minutes. Most adults go through four to five sleep cycles per night. However, the length and number of sleep cycles can vary depending on factors such as age, sleep quality, and sleep disorders.

How can you improve your sleep cycle?

To improve the quality of your sleep, it's essential to optimize your sleep cycle.

Here are some tips:

Stick to a consistent sleep schedule: Try to go to bed and wake up at the same time every day, even on weekends.

Create a relaxing sleep environment: Make sure your bedroom is dark, quiet, and cool. Use comfortable pillows and a mattress.

Avoid caffeine and alcohol: Caffeine and alcohol can disrupt your sleep cycle and make it harder to fall asleep.

Limit screen time: Blue light from electronic devices can interfere with your body's production of melatonin, a hormone that helps regulate your sleep-wake cycle. Avoid using electronic devices before bed.

Exercise regularly: Regular exercise can help regulate your sleep cycle and improve the quality of your sleep.


Understanding your sleep cycle can help you optimize your sleep and improve your overall health and well-being. By sticking to a consistent sleep schedule, creating a relaxing sleep environment, avoiding caffeine and alcohol, limiting screen time, and exercising regularly, you can improve the quality of your sleep and wake up feeling refreshed and energized

                                          HISTORY OF THE NOBEL PRIZE 





The Nobel Prize is one of the most prestigious awards in the world, given annually in recognition of achievements in physics, chemistry, medicine or physiology, literature, and peace. The prizes were established by the Swedish inventor Alfred Nobel, who left the majority of his wealth to the creation of the awards in 1895.

The Nobel Prizes are awarded by the Nobel Foundation, which was established in 1900. The foundation is responsible for administering the awards, as well as promoting scientific research and cultural exchange. The prizes are awarded annually in Stockholm, Sweden, except for the peace prize, which is awarded in Oslo, Norway.

The first Nobel Prizes were awarded in 1901, and since then they have been given to many of the world's most renowned scientists, writers, and peacemakers. Some of the most famous recipients of the Nobel Prize include Marie Curie, who won the prize in physics and chemistry, Albert Einstein, who won the prize in physics, and Martin Luther King Jr., who won the prize for peace.

Over the years, the Nobel Prize has become one of the most respected and sought-after awards in the world, and it continues to play a major role in promoting scientific and cultural exchange.
